Output e24cfaa1a58ba10b0b19545cef920af5fbc3aa66f49ef2e424cb0d9c25193e1a:19

value
6750000
script pubkey
OP_0 OP_PUSHBYTES_20 828dfd66f85c13b52a02a53ca9251f01393e3788
address
ltc1qs2xl6ehctsfm22sz5572jfglqyunudugp5zmtv
transaction
e24cfaa1a58ba10b0b19545cef920af5fbc3aa66f49ef2e424cb0d9c25193e1a
spent
true